An industrial ice machine is a high-capacity machine designed to create ice on a commercial scale. This machine is often used in industrial applications such as manufacturing, food and beverage product processing, and pharmaceutical industries where product refrigeration is necessary. Just like a smaller-scale ice maker turns liquids into ice, the commercial version creates ice more efficiently using various techniques.

Commercial ice makers have a refrigeration system consisting of compressors, condensers, evaporators, and expansion valves, all of which are used to create cold temperatures for the ice-making process. The compressor compresses a refrigerant gas, then flows to the condenser, releasing heat and transforming it into a high-pressure liquid. Next, the liquid refrigerant passes through the expansion valve, causing it to expand and evaporate. An evaporator inside of the machine will typically receive refrigerant while in its gas state then ultimately turn water into ice cubes. These ice machines are all designed to freeze water quickly and at a rate that is necessary for temperature control within commercial use.

There are several ways to choose the ideal ice machine. For starters, you will want to choose the type of ice you need for your commercial use or application. Ice can be created in different thicknesses as well as ice types and shapes from a flake to a cube. Then, you'll want to determine the capacity and size. There are nugget ice machines, flake ice machines, and units with a larger capacity ice bin. The more specifications you can narrow it down to, the better.
